[PATCH 1/3] Fix setting of irq trigger type in UIC driver
From: David Gibson <hidden>
Date: 2007-08-14 03:52:42
The UIC (interrupt controller in 4xx embedded CPUs) driver currently missets the IRQ_lEVEL flag in desc->status, due to a thinko. This patch fixes the bug. Currently this is only a cosmetic problem (affects the output in /proc/interrupts), however subsequent patches will use the IRQ_LEVEL flag to affect flow handling.
